Real-Time GPS Tracking is one such technology that involves satellite positioning systems to track the precise position and movement of the heavy equipment in real time. It enables rental companies to monitor equipment like excavators, loaders, cranes and tractors at any given time. The information is relayed using GPS devices to equipments, and shown on a dashboard in the central place. This provides improved control, security and visibility of operations. Equipment theft is a serious issue in rental operations, leading to major financial setbacks. Tracking systems enable the companies to know the location and the activity of the machinery at any time. Immediately when unauthorized movement or misuse is detected alerts are produced. Geofencing also provides additional security by establishing safe zones and alerting managers when equipment is out of bounds. This quick response capability helps recover assets faster, reduces losses and improves overall security management across job sites effectively and efficiently.

Billing is usually done manually, which results into mistakes and conflicts. By delivering accurate information on usage, such as the length of the rental, the hours of work, and the idle time, GPS tracking removes these problems. This will facilitate proper invoicing of actual equipment use. Clients are charged reasonably, and businesses are transparent in their activities. Automated data collection decreases the administrative cost and makes the financial operations more efficient and accurate.
